In your latest email, you amended your request to the following: 
 
1. Any monitoring systems, datasets, or responsibilities the Ministry holds, or 
coordinates with other agencies, regarding ship emissions regulated under Annex VI 
(SOx, NOx, PM, VOCs) in New Zealand’s territorial waters (within 12 nautical miles) 
and Exclusive Economic Zone (12–200 nautical miles). 
2. Any reports, datasets, or assessments that consider the potential impacts of ship 
emissions on atmospheric conditions, cloud formation, or weather/climate in New 
Zealand. 
3. Any correspondence between the Ministry and other agencies (Maritime NZ, EPA, 
NIWA) between 1 January 2022 and 1 December 2025 that references Annex VI 
compliance and potential weather or climate impacts of ship emissions.

The Ministry holds data about aggregate shipping emissions in New Zealand as part of New 
Zealand’s Greenhouse Gas Inventory, which is outside the scope of your request but which 
you may find useful. You can find this information online at: https://environment.govt.nz/
publications/new-zealands-greenhouse-gas-inventory-19902023/ 
by clicking on “Common 
Reporting output tables”. This data is not organised by movement in or out of New Zealand 
territorial waters and does not distinguish between emissions in territorial waters and the 
EEZ.

I am releasing one email in part, with some information (including one attachment) withheld 
under the following sections of the Act: 
6(a)  
as the making available of that information would be likely to prejudice the 
international relations of the Government of New Zealand. 
6(b)(ii)  
as the making available of that information would be likely to prejudice the 
entrusting of information to the Government of New Zealand on a basis of 
confidence by any international organisation. 
9(2)(j)  
to enable a Minister of the Crown or any public service agency or 
organisation holding the information to carry on, without prejudice or 
disadvantage, negotiations.
